What they do
An Administrative Clerk or Coordinator performs administrative work in an office. Coordinates work to support an office team. Works in a wide variety of office settings, such as a company or business, or a government office or school. Manages paper and electronic files, uses office equipment including computers, responds to phone calls and emails. May manage office staff expenses, supplies or schedules.
